About Yu Xue

Yu Xue is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Environmental Chemistry, Organic Chemistry, Nephrology and Genetics, having authored 9 papers that have together received 363 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Environmental Chemistry and Analysis (2 papers), Moringa oleifera research and applications (1 paper), Water Treatment and Disinfection (1 paper), DNA and Nucleic Acid Chemistry (1 paper), Antimicrobial agents and applications (1 paper), Gout, Hyperuricemia, Uric Acid (1 paper), Rheumatoid Arthritis Research and Therapies (1 paper) and Analytical chemistry methods development (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Nephrology (197 citations), Pathology and Forensic Medicine (47 citations), Pharmacology (22 citations), Molecular Biology (84 citations) and Complementary and alternative medicine (8 citations). Yu Xue has collaborated with scholars based in China. Frequent co-authors include Zhenping Zhao, Maigeng Zhou, Jing Wu, Zhengjing Huang, Xiaoxia Zhu, Xiao Zhang, Weiguo Wan, Chun Li, Hejian Zou and Limin Wang. Their work appears in journals such as Phytomedicine, The Science of The Total Environment, Biosensors and Bioelectronics, Forests and Frontiers in Immunology.
